Market performance percentile reveals brand's competitive strength and customer preference within the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
Hungry Lion holds a leading market performance position in Zambia's Cafe & Restaurants industry with a percentile of 99. This shows a strong customer preference. Performance peers include Steers, Nawab's Kitchen, Debonairs Pizza, Nando's, Fox & hound makeni mall, and La Piazzetta, all within the same leading percentile range.
Customer satisfaction is a key performance indicator to gauge brand loyalty and predict future business success.
Hungry Lion's overall customer satisfaction in Zambia is 73%, a decrease of 5.7 percentage points year-over-year. Lusaka Province shows a CSAT of 72% with a decrease of 9.8 percentage points, while Central Province has a CSAT of 71% with an increase of 20.6 percentage points.
Number of outlets indicates brand's reach and penetration in different regions, reflecting expansion and accessibility.
Hungry Lion has 45 outlets in Lusaka Province, 19 in Copperbelt Province, 6 in Southern Province, 4 in Central Province, 2 each in Eastern and North-Western Provinces, and 1 each in Western, Northern and Luapula Provinces.
Identifying main competitors highlights competitive landscape and strategic positioning within the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
Hungry Lion's top competitors in Zambia, based on customer cross-visitation, are RocoMamas (9.49%), Debonairs Pizza (9.49%), Nando's (8.86%), KFC (6.96%), and Keg (6.96%). This indicates shared customer base and competitive overlap.
Traffic workload distribution informs staffing, marketing strategies by understanding peak hours and customer flow.
Hungry Lion experiences peak traffic workload between 8 AM and 8 PM in Zambia, with the highest traffic around 6 PM (57.13%) and 7 PM (58.48%). Traffic is minimal between midnight and 7 AM.
Consumer segment analysis informs targeted marketing and positioning strategies by understanding customer demographics.
Women have a high affinity (72) while Men have high affinity (112) towards Hungry Lion, this data suggests under-representation of the female segment, and higher than average engagement from men. Gen X consumers show very high affinity (317), signaling strong brand resonance, indicating high affinity for Hungry Lion.
